07 - MySQLi - Eliminar registos.

article featured image

Hoje, vamos focar-nos no processo de eliminação de registos da tabela product na nossa base de dados. A eliminação de dados é uma tarefa crítica, e é fundamental garantir que este procedimento seja realizado de forma segura e eficiente.

Vamos começar por criar o ficheiro product_del.php que receberá o parâmetro proid na URL, permitindo-nos identificar qual registo deve ser eliminado.

Assim como na aula anterior, 06 - MySQLi - Editar registos, é necessário garantir que recebemos o campo proid pelo URL que vai identificar o registo a eliminar. No entanto, vou fazer uma abordagem diferente, até para poderem verificar que há várias formas de resolver o mesmo problema:

 

Mais uma vez, vamos realizar a alteração no ficheiro index.php para garantir o correto funcionamento do nosso botão de Eliminar:

 

Com este procedimento, aprendemos a eliminar registos de forma segura na tabela product. Na próxima aula, vamos explorar como implementar um sistema de confirmação mais robusto e talvez até um sistema de registo de alterações para manter um histórico das operações realizadas.

 

Post Anterior